A Change in This Year's Sessions

by Emer Lawn

Posted on Friday 9 January 2009

This year's conference is coming at the ideal time, as so many of us question our plans for 2009 and want to know what will keep us going during the gloomy economic climate.

Search Marketing World 2009 promises to take a look at the usual Search Marketing topics from a new perspective, and it is clear that the cost-effective models of Social Media will not be overlooked. Social Media Marketing has become a close friend to Search Engine Marketing, and so this year's conference will feature sessions that delve into this topic in great detail.

One such session "Social Media Marketing: Redifining the Customer" will tackle the need for a reevaluation in perspective when dealing with the wants and needs of our target audiences. For so many brands and companies, partaking in social media has already proved tremendously beneficial; but many others have found it hard to become active members of these social communities. A panel of experts at this year's conference in April will help us to better understand the "Web 2.0 Customers" and how we can communicate with them,as opposed to throwing messages at them.

Other sessions that focus on this growing friend to SEM include: "Search 3.0: Video, Local, and Blended Results" and "CSS and AJAX for the Web 2.0 Customer"
